Saint-Etienne are lining up an approach for Espanyol's Raul Tamudo as they look to bolster their forward line after seeing Bafe Gomis move to Lyon, according to a report.

Les Verts believe that the veteran striker could given them the experience they need up-front and are set to make an enquiry to Espanyol, RMC radio state.

Tamudo is available for around €2.5million after reaching a deal with the Blanc i Blau that he could leave this summer should a club meet the asking price.

While several Premier League sides have been linked with the Spain international, no concrete offers have been made and he is going through pre-season training with Espanyol.

Italian sides have also shown an interest and Tamudo has revealed he could be tempted by Serie A, but a move to France may also appeal to the 31-year-old.

The Santa Coloma-born goalscorer has spent his entire career with Espanyol and wants to experience playing for a different side before he retires.
